The Houston Factor: Heavy Humidity, Pollen Explosions, and Attic Mold

Operating a central air filtration network in our specific regional climate introduces severe, unique environmental demands that traditional home filters were never engineered to handle.

Houston’s heat and humidity place extreme strain on AC systems. Because our cooling season routinely runs for up to ten months out of the year, your central system moves massive volumes of warm, moisture-laden air through dark duct lines every single hour. This high relative humidity creates a perfect breeding ground for biological mold and mildew growth along your system’s internal evaporator coils and drain pans.

Furthermore, our local environment deals with intense seasonal tree pollen spikes and heavy industrial smog. When these outdoor pollutants seep inside your home through microscopic window gaps, they hit your dark, damp HVAC interior and bond with household dust. This combination circulates a steady stream of allergens through your vents every time the fan turns on. True indoor air quality experts install active purification hardware that destroys these microscopic threats before they can spread to your living areas.

Our Premium Whole-Home Air Purification Solutions Explained

We don’t believe in generic, one-size-fits-all filtration products. When you partner with us to upgrade your building’s environment, our certified specialists design a custom system using the industry’s most advanced air-cleaning technologies:

Medical-Grade Whole-Home HEPA Filtration

We install high-capacity High-Efficiency Particulate Air (HEPA) systems directly into your bypass return tracks. These dense filters are mechanically certified to capture up to 99.97% of all microscopic particulate matter down to an incredibly fine 0.3 microns—instantly eliminating deep-tissue allergens, fine dust, and pollen tracks.

Photohydroionization (PHI) and UV-C Germicidal Lights

Instead of simply trapping passing debris, we mount active ultraviolet (UV-C) air purifiers directly above your indoor cooling coils. This specialized light array targets and alters the DNA of organic matter, permanently neutralizing mold spores, bacterial cultures, and floating airborne viruses safely.

Why Professional, In-Duct Installation is Vital

Trying to manage your property’s breathing conditions with portable retail appliances or by letting an uncertified contractor cut into your system’s sheet metal can lead to severe structural and operational issues.

  • Preserving System Airflow Dynamics: High-density filters like HEPA introduce massive static resistance. If an amateur contractor slides a heavy filter into a standard return slot without adjusting your system’s blower fan speed, it can choke your system’s airflow, leading to a frozen evaporator coil and a burned-out blower motor early.
  • Factory Equipment Warranty Protection: Major heating and cooling manufacturers will instantly invalidate your 10-year parts warranty if an unlicensed individual alters your central duct paths or wires auxiliary electrical systems incorrectly.
  • True Ozone Safety Certifications: A professional mechanical team only installs modern, CARB-certified, zero-ozone air purifiers. These systems safely clean your air stream without emitting harmful chemical byproducts.

FAQ: Navigating Air Purification Investments

Q: What is the main difference between a standard air filter and a whole-home air purifier?

A: Standard fiberglass air filters are designed strictly to capture large chunks of lint and hair to prevent them from damaging your AC blower motor. Whole-home air purifiers are installed directly inside your central duct lines to actively neutralize microscopic viruses, bacteria, gas odors, and fine allergens across your entire property.

Q: How often do I need to replace the core elements in a whole-house air purifier?

A: While standard 1-inch filters require changes every month, premium whole-home media cartridges or HEPA filters feature deep surface tracks that only require replacement once every 6 to 12 months, depending on your indoor occupancy and pet levels.

Q: Do UV air purifiers really destroy viruses and bacteria inside my duct lines?

A: Yes. High-intensity UV-C germicidal lights emit specific light wavelengths that disrupt the genetic bonds of organic pathogens. This renders biological contaminants completely inert and unable to reproduce when they pass through your central air stream.

Q: Can a professional air purifier installation help lower my monthly electric bills?

A: Yes. By keeping your indoor evaporator coils completely clear of dust, pet hair, and mold films, your air conditioner can exchange heat much faster. This allows the system to run shorter, highly efficient operational cycles that lower your total energy consumption.
